Constants for Pressgate's incremental rebuild scheduler. We only rebuild pages whose content hash or template dependency changed, batching dirty pages per wave to keep worker memory flat. Debounce prevents thrashing when editors save repeatedly; the full-rebuild fallback triggers only when the dependency graph exceeds the staleness bound. Reviewers: changing these requires re-running the Holloway benchmark suite. The current values are defined immediately below.

tuning constants:
QUOTAS = {
    "druwyn": 5,
    "holix": 5,
    "zorath": 5,
    "holwyn": 10,
}

/*
 * Client setup for the Userbridge service.
 * As part of splitting the Ombra monolith, the user module now lives
 * in its own deployment, and this client replaces the old in-process
 * calls to the accounts package. Profile reads and session checks go
 * through Userbridge; writes still hit the monolith until phase two.
 * Timeouts and retries mirror the monolith defaults, so behavior
 * should be unchanged for callers. The client authenticates with the
 * internal key configured immediately below.
 */

API key for yahig-tadup: kto7_ubizbYm

# Loyalty Programme Overhaul — Managers Only

This page documents the planned restructuring of the Silverbough Rewards scheme for sales leads. The revised model replaces annual point expiry with rolling twelve-month windows and introduces a partner-earn tier tested in the Marrowfield pilot. Training materials follow next month. The strategic context for the overhaul is provided in the confidential note below.

board note of bawep-tajef: Queniusek Systems plans to raise the Quenvan list price by 53.1 percent in March. The pricing group signed off on a budget of $176.4 million for Project Drueth. The renewal with Casionix Partners closes at $142.5 million a year, 8.3 percent below the last contract. Project Fraax slips by six weeks because of the tooling delay.

Handover Note — Regional Sales Review

From outgoing director P. Selvane to incoming director R. Okkert, for the board. Northern region at 94% of plan; Westmoor territory weak. Pipeline for Cravenhall accounts is solid. Quarterly review pack filed. One open negotiation pending sign-off. The confidential item below is for board eyes only.

confidential, kajof-tahof: The pricing group signed off on a budget of $491.8 million for Project Casvan.